FromSoftware’s Secret Project FMC: A Mystery Title for Late 2025 Revealed
FromSoftware’s secret project, codenamed FMC, is reportedly deep in development and could release by late 2025. This title joins other studio projects, including The Duskbloods for Switch 2 and ongoing post-launch support for Elden Ring: Nightfalls. Guesses are circulating regarding the meaning of “FMC,” especially given FromSoftware’s history of “F”-prefixed project names associated with franchises like Dark Souls and Armored Core. This has led to theories that FMC could be a remaster of Dark Souls III or an expansion for Armored Core VI: Fires of Rubicon. A less prominent theory suggests it might be a brand-new intellectual property. Despite The Duskbloods being an online PvPvE game, FromSoftware President Hidetaka Miyazaki has assured fans that single-player games will not be overlooked. He confirmed that the team will continue to create traditional, solo-focused titles, much like Elden Ring.
